The moment you entertain the enemies whispers you open the door to fear. "Your going to die, your going to freeze, your going to starve. No one cares, your finished, God is mad at you, you are going to be homeless." Do these words sound familiar, he never changes his threats. These are key phrases he uses to shake you loose from your faith and start you running. Running in circles, first in your mind, then in your body. "The wicked flee when no man pursueth: but the righteous are bold as a lion." Proverbs 28:1 

Those that have no more personal agenda and love Me with all their heart, have nothing to fear, they understand My eye is on them every second. "Are not two little sparrows sold for a penny? And yet not one of them will fall to the ground without your Father's leave (consent) and notice. [30] But even the very hairs of your head are all numbered. [31] Fear not, then; you are of more value than many sparrows." Matthew 10:29-31 (AMP)

Do you believe Me or him, if you fear, then he is winning you over, to the bondage of fear. "For ye have not received the spirit of bondage again to fear; but ye have received the Spirit of adoption, whereby we cry, Abba, Father." Romans 8:15 (KJV) To believe Me in the good times is no faith at all. You don't need a flashlight in the sunshine, you need it, in the pitch black. Faith is that flashlight. If you are sold out to Me and in constant communication with Me, your batteries will stay charged, and be ready for the dark times.

The foundation of My kingdom is faith,..."without faith it is impossible to please him : for he that cometh to God must believe that he is, and that he is a rewarder of them that diligently seek him." Hebrews 11:6   Most Christians are not able to grasp the seriousness of faith in the kingdom. Don't you understand, you will burn in hell without it.  The whole foundation of satan's kingdom is fear, ..." the fearful... shall have their part in the lake which burneth with fire and brimstone: which is the second death". Revelation 21:8

Fear itself is hell on earth. Fear will lead to panic and panic leads to running toward insanity. Many times I use fear, as a weapon against My enemies. It can destroy a mighty army in minutes.
